Q: Is 4,470,160 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 4,470,160 is a composite number.

Why is 4,470,160 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 4,470,160 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 5 8 10 16 20 40 71 80 142 284 355 568 710 787 1,136 1,420 1,574 2,840 3,148 3,935 5,680 6,296 7,870 12,592 15,740 31,480 55,877 62,960 111,754 223,508 279,385 447,016 558,770 894,032 1,117,540 2,235,080 and 4,470,160, with no remainder.

Since 4,470,160 cannot be divided by just 1 and 4,470,160, it is a composite number.
